Can you eat after a dental filling?

  • Can you eat after a dental filling? It depends on whether there are numb areas, including the cheek or lips, not just the tooth itself. If you're still feeling numb, there's a risk of accidentally biting those areas while eating. It's better to wait until the numbness wears off completely, and then you can eat comfortably without any worries. 🦷😊
